We ate dinner at L’Aile having passed it during a cycle ride and been impressed by the positive reviews on the web. There is a fixed price menu which works out at 35 euros for three courses. My partner had smoked mussels followed by mixed...grill of fish whilst I had pannacotta of mozzarella followed by veal and chorizo kebabs. Everything was very well cooked and although it was hard to find fault with anything, it wasn’t quite the stellar gourmet experience some have alluded to. Perhaps we didn’t choose well. The wine list was long and very good value for money.

We have cycled past this place umpteen times and promised ourselves a visit, and got the chance this trip. The food was a real change from other local restaurants, and we all thoroughly enjoyed the mussels smoked over pine needles. Our mains were varied and...delicious, and my desert must surely be in my top ten ever or best deserts. Served well, a fair price for great food. Will be back again soon.
